What is a Virtual Tech job?

A Virtual Tech job involves providing remote technical support, troubleshooting, and IT assistance to clients or businesses. Virtual Techs help resolve software, hardware, and network issues without needing to be physically present. They may also assist with system updates, cybersecurity measures, and general IT maintenance. This role requires strong problem-solving skills, technical knowledge, and communication abilities. Many Virtual Techs work for IT support companies, help desks, or as freelancers.

What are some common daily responsibilities for a Virtual Tech?

As a Virtual Tech, your daily tasks typically include responding to user support tickets, troubleshooting hardware and software issues remotely, and monitoring system performance using specialized tools. You may be responsible for installing updates, managing device configurations, and ensuring cybersecurity protocols are followed. Collaboration with other IT professionals and effective communication with end-users are key components of the role. This position often involves independent work as well as participation in virtual team meetings to assess priorities and resolve complex technical challenges.

Position Overview
The T2 Service Desk Analyst Technician provides expeditious support leveraged through various backend platforms to meet and exceed goals and expectations that have been stipulated by clients. While support is primarily performed through remote methods. The Tier 2 role will ensure that issues can be resolved on a first touch/phone call
Day-To-Day Duties and Responsibilities
โ€ข Utilize IT Service Management (ITSM) systems (e.g., ConnectWise, ServiceNow, Jira Service Management) to log, track, and resolve incidents, ensuring accurate documentation and SLA compliance.
โ€ข Provide clear, professional communication with end users, both written and verbal, to ensure technical issues are explained and progress updates are transparent.
โ€ข Troubleshoot and resolve computer-related issues with end users remotely and over the phone.
โ€ข Proactively monitor tickets to prevent larger issues from occurring with a focus on P1 and VIP User tickets and trends.
โ€ข Identify and remove viruses, malware, and browser infections.
โ€ข Manage accounts through Microsoft Active Directory/Entra ID and Office 365.
โ€ข Setup and configuration of Microsoft Office products and many other software products.
โ€ข Monitor and fix issues related to customer backups.
โ€ข Handle issues in an organized fashion through a ticketing system with regular customer updates.
โ€ข Communicate with coworkers to escalate tickets to Tier 3 Technicians as needed.
โ€ข Back up Tier 1 on the phones and tickets as needed.
โ€ข Training, mentoring, and supporting T1 Help Desk Technicians.
Minimum Qualifications
โ€ข Relevant IT certifications (e.g., CompTIA A+, Network+, Microsoft 365, ITIL) or proof of formal IT training.
โ€ข Strong verbal and written communication skills with the ability to communicate technical information clearly to non-technical users.
โ€ข Experience using IT Service Management (ITSM) systems such as ConnectWise, ServiceNow, or Jira Service Management.
โ€ข 2 years previous customer service experience.
โ€ข Excellent with oral and written communication.
โ€ข Ability to quickly solve problems.
โ€ข Flexibility in a dynamic work environment.
โ€ข Multitasking and completing projects according to their scheduled deadlines.
